“My child disappeared overnight.”

That’s one of the most heartbreaking things a parent has ever said to me in my office.

One day their kid was fine. The next: sudden OCD, rage episodes, anxiety, tics, food restriction.

This is the hallmark of PANS and PANDAS. And it is NOT a psychiatric disorder.

It’s an immune response. The infection triggers the immune system to produce antibodies that attack parts of the brain, specifically the basal ganglia.

When we treat the infection and reduce the inflammation, those children often come back.

Most people are taught that inflammation is bad: something to suppress and push through.

But inflammation is your immune system doing exactly what it was designed to do: respond to a threat.

The real question isn’t: how do I turn off the inflammation?

It’s: what is TRIGGERING the inflammation?

For many of my patients, the answer is a hidden infection, mold exposure, gut dysbiosis, or a toxic burden the body simply can’t clear on its own.

When we find the trigger and address it, that’s when the inflammation actually resolves.
